Output 656863bae1b4ef89991940107b41044368cb9d91502e740a32c8e0d296f23d45:0

value
8379922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 633922b6442ce4b39e795a549a1fd85131a87cb7 OP_EQUAL
address
3AjfGPKSeNqHz9usBSpJhp8ez2DdYJkKXW
transaction
656863bae1b4ef89991940107b41044368cb9d91502e740a32c8e0d296f23d45
spent
true